Ed Sheeran’s Copyright Infringement Battles

Biswajit Sarkar Copyright Blog

Looking back, his career trajectory has been laced with a healthy amount of plagiarism allegations by other artists. Three of the most prominent accusations of plagiarism are with regard to his songs “Photograph”, “Thinking Out Loud”, and “Shape of You”. 2018 saw the continuation of Sheeran’s struggles with infringement allegations.
